"John FitzPatrick, 1st Earl of Upper Ossory (1719 \u2013 23 September 1758) was an Anglo-Irish nobleman who lived in County Cork, Ireland. He was the son of Richard FitzPatrick, 1st Baron Gowran, and Anne (n\u00E9e Robinson) and educated at Queen's College, Oxford. He succeeded his father as 2nd Baron Gowran in 1727 and his mother to the estates of Farmingwoods (now Fermyn Woods), Northamptonshire and Ampthill, Bedfordshire in 1744. He was created Earl of Upper Ossory in the Irish peerage on 5 October 1751. He was MP for Bedfordshire from 1753 to 1758. He married Lady Evelyn Leveson-Gower, daughter of the 1st Earl Gower, on 29 June 1744. They had four children: \n* John FitzPatrick, Lord Gowran, later 2nd Earl of Upper Ossory (1745\u20131818) \n* The Hon. Richard FitzPatrick (24 January 1748 \u2013 25 April 1813) \n* The Lady Mary FitzPatrick (bef. 1751 \u2013 6 October 1778), married the 2nd Baron Holland and had issue. \n* The Lady Louisa FitzPatrick (1755 \u2013 7 August 1789), married the 2nd Earl of Shelburne (later the 1st Marquess of Lansdowne) and had issue including Henry Petty-Fitzmaurice, 3rd Marquess of Lansdowne."@en . . . . . . . . .
